Capitalism has historically been our biggest blessing. But what if it’s now turning into our biggest curse?

My guest this week

believes so. Jim is an early internet pioneer, a complexity scientist, the former chairman of the Santa Fe Institute, and co-founder of the Game B movement... and he has a lot to say about how our economic and technological systems have trapped us in addictive, self-reinforcing feedback loops.

From smartphones engineered like slot machines to markets that manufacture desire rather than meet real needs, he argues that our current “Game A” world runs on a single signal — money-on-money return — and that this growth-at-all-costs monoculture is rapidly eroding our agency, our sanity, and our planetary stability.

This is where “Game B” comes in: a post-capitalist operating system built on multidimensional value, regenerative economies, and what he calls “membranes” — local, self-governing communities that cooperate through trust, technology, and shared sensemaking rather than rivalry and coercion.

So if, like me, you increasingly feel that modern life is engineered to keep us divided and distracted, and want to understand how to fix it, I highly recommend this episode.
